Contact Management

The module allows you to view, add, edit, deactivate, delete, and manage users within your organization.


  1. Filters. Filter by Contact Type, Status, Role Name, and Authorized User.
  2. Contact Management List. Displays all your contacts along with their details:
    • Name
    • Organization Name
    • Email Address
    • Contact Type (Primary, Secondary, Onsite Member)
    • Roles
    • Status (Pending, Active, Inactive)
  3. Create New Button (explained in the next section)
  4. Search Bar. Search users by name or email.
  5. Three-Dot Menu Options for each contact:
    • Edit – Modify contact details
    • Delete – Remove the User
    • Resend – Resend the invitation email for pending users
    • Deactivate/Activate – Toggle user account status
    • Authorize User – Grant access to the client portal
    • Profile Details – View detailed user information
    • Note: If a user is inactive, the only action available in the three-dot menu is Activate.
  6. Client Roles
    • Client Admin 
      • The primary contact of the company.
      • Add members and set a role for each user under your organization
      • To add, edit, or delete users from the Connexus client Web App.
      • To configure and set some features/functions and privileges.
    • Property Manager
      • Has a limited set of privileges set by the Client Admin. 
      • Can access and view the Client Detail page by clicking the Client tab. All other permissions are disabled.
      • If the property manager does not have Admin permission, the contact and role management permissions are disabled.
      • When navigating to the Property List, Contracts, or RFPs, you will only see the properties they are associated with.
  7. Creating a New User
    • Click the Create button on the contact management list page.
    • Fill in the form fields with the necessary information. 
    • Once done, a confirmation email is sent to the user.
    • Status changes to Active once the user sets the password via the email link.
  8. Editing a User
    • Click the Edit icon in the contact management list.
      • Actions
      • Update: Saves changes to the record.
      • Cancel: Discards changes.
      • Authorize User: Sending this to “Yes” triggers an invitation email to the registered email address.
  9. Deleting a User
    • Click “Delete” in the three-dot menu.
    • A confirmation pop-up will appear:
    • Confirming deletion removes you from the system.
    • The same email can be reused to create a new user.
  10. Resending Invitation
    • Available only for users with Pending status.
    • Click Resend in the three-dot menu to send a new invitation email.
    • Previous links have expired, and the new link is active for 24 hours.
  11. Deactivating / Activating User
    • Deactivate: Available for Active users only.
    • Edit is disabled for deactivated accounts.


Assigning or Unassigning a Contact (Manager, Regional Manager, or Any Contact Type) to One or Multiple Properties


  1. Access the Contact List in the Client Dashboard
    • In the client detail page, click the Contacts tab. All contacts associated with that client will appear.
    • If the contact is not listed:
      • Go to the Contact Management module from the left menu.
      • Create a new contact there.
      • Return to the Client → Contacts tab.
  2. Open the Contact Assignment Options
    • Locate the contact you want to modify.
    • Click the three dots (⋮) on the right side of the contact row.
    • Select “Link to Specific Properties.”
  3. Select Property-Level Assignment
    • A pop-up window will appear:
    • Choose the Property Level option using the radio button.
    • This ensures the contact is linked to individual properties instead of the entire client.
  4. Assign or Unassign Properties
    • Click the Select Properties dropdown.
    • To assign properties, check the properties you want linked to the contact.
    • To unassign, simply uncheck any property you want removed from the contact.
  5. Save and Update Property Assignments
    • After making your selections, click Link.
    • The system will update the assignments and save the contact-to-property relationships.
    • Your contact is now successfully assigned or unassigned from the selected properties.
